Why breakup, divorce and domestic abuse are your business. Understanding their impact on businesses and for employees in the workplace. ' Recent research statistics showing the devastating impact of breakups on the workplace and on the business bottom line (including a 40% reduction in productivity for up to 3 years and 1 in 10 leaving their jobs) ' How breakups and divorce can affect employees including absenteeism, sickness, stress, uncontrollable emotions and poor decision making. ' The challenges for employees dealing with breakups whilst working ' How to emotionally and practically support employees navigating this process ' How to dramatically reduce the impact on the business What is domestic abuse and how does this impact the workplace: ' Recent statistics on domestic abuse including stats showing that over 21% of full time employees have experienced domestic abuse and 9 out of 10 of them said it impacted their performance at work ' What is domestic abuse ' How to spot the signs of employees struggling with abusive relationships ' How to emotionally and practically support employees with abusive partners ' How to minimise impact on the business ' How to safeguard and signpost
